From 8c26aa2496e041c98bd85d43d54523c33705b994 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?K=C3=A9vin=20Gomez?= Date: Fri, 18 Oct 2024 12:03:02 +0200 Subject: [PATCH] Cache go vendors in CI diff preview action --- .../workflows/grafana-foundation-sdk-diff-preview.yaml |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/.github/workflows/grafana-foundation-sdk-diff-preview.yaml b/.github/workflows/grafana-foundation-sdk-diff-preview.yaml index 27e7aba5..78ce614e 100644 --- a/.github/workflows/grafana-foundation-sdk-diff-preview.yaml +++ b/.github/workflows/grafana-foundation-sdk-diff-preview.yaml @@ -13,6 +13,15 @@ jobs: steps: - uses: actions/checkout@v4 + - name: Restore go vendors + uses: actions/cache@v4 + with: + path: | + vendor + key: go-deps-${{ runner.os }}-primes-${{ hashFiles('go.sum') }} + restore-keys: | + go-deps-${{ runner.os }} + - name: Install devbox uses: jetify-com/devbox-install-action@v0.11.0 with: